It carries a 175-280 VAC coil and includes an auxiliary switch block, so it's a self-contained unit for applications needing feedback or interlock contacts without adding a separate aux stack. The screw-type magnet coil terminals and the built-in auxiliary switch mean this is a 'fit and wire' part for a panel builder — no extra modules to order for basic signaling.
Mounting and panel fit — the DIN rail reality
The S2 footprint is 75 mm wide, 114 mm tall, and 130 mm deep — that's the depth you need to budget for gland-plate clearance behind the rail. That zero forward clearance means you can butt the contactor against a back panel or another device without derating — useful when packing a dense row.
The coil pulls 25 A inrush peak, then holds at the rated 175-280 VAC range. Pickup dropout time is 30-55 ms AC or DC; arcing time runs 10-20 ms. The auxiliary switch is rated for switching: 10 A at 24 V, 2 A at 48 V or 60 V, 1 A at 110 V, 0.9 A at 125 V, 0.3 A at 220 V, 6 A at 230 V, 3 A at 400 V, and 1 A at 440 V. That's a wide voltage spread — the 6 A at 230 V covers most European control circuits, while the 0.3 A at 220 V handles lower-power signaling. The 10 A at 24 V is your DC interlock or PLC input workhorse. Wire capacity on the aux terminals: 2x 0.5-1.5 mm² solid or 2x 0.75-2.5 mm² stranded — standard for control wiring.
Operating environment and mechanical endurance
That -40 °C low end means it's fine in unheated enclosures or cold storage areas — no heater needed for startup. Maximum switching rate at AC-1 is 350 operations per hour — enough for most conveyor or pump cycling, but not for high-speed pick-and-place.
